Dopamine dilemma: case report of treating psychosis in patient with retinitis pigmentosa

Retinitis Pigmentosa is a rare inherited degenerative eye disease affecting the retinal pigment epithelium (RPE), in which mutation of rhodopsin leads to severe visual impairment, and legal blindness.
